-
SWITCH PUSH SPST-NC 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
3084T-F-632-SS
RAF Electronic Hardware
345-042-524-807
EDAC Inc.
TP3410J304-X
Texas Instruments
M80-8243422
Harwin Inc.
RN73H1ETTP3000C25
KOA Speer Electronics, Inc.